John Denver is a popular singer and songwriter who has touched a lot of people with his songs. Many of these are based on Colorado. Henry John Deutschendorf Jr. was born in Roswell, New Mexico. He was enthralled by Colorado and settled in Aspen. Denver's famous songs about his home state encouraged many to move to Colorado. G. Brown, curator of the Colorado Music Hall of Fame said it was because John Denver is the only performer to embody Colorado. Denver was one of the very initial Hall of Fame inductee in the year 2011. Today he personifies the state across the globe. Certainly in my travels you meet someone from the opposite end of the planet, someone of New Zealand and you say "I'm from Colorado and the first word that comes they say is Oh John Denver! Brown stated. Take Me Home Country Roads was among Denver's top 10 solo hit after appearing with small folk bands. It was written, co-written and produced by Bill Danoff. Danoff wrote the tune to imitate the style of Johnny Cash, but Denver was able to hear the song's early versions and was aware that it would become a top 10 pop hit. Danoff recorded the track in just a few weeks when he performed it in front of an enthusiastic audience who were in Washington D.C.
